- Rabbitry
- A rabbit-raising enterprise or a place where domestic rabbits are kept.

- Racy
- A term meaning slim, trim, slender in body and legs, hare like, alert, and active.

- Registrar
- A person who, after taking a test and meeting other eligibility requirements, is certified by ARBA to evaluate rabbits and register them if they meet standards. ARBA sanctioned shows are required to have a registrar available.

- Registration
- The process of certifying that a rabbit meets the qualifications established by the ARBA for that breed and has a three-generation pedigree (see above). Requires examination by a licensed registrar.

- REW
- Ruby-eyed white; white bunny with ruby eyes resulting from two REW (cc) genes.
